Verizon, for instance, charges your data consumption whenever you make a video call using VoLTE. An average one-minute call will consume 6-8 MB of data. So watch out for your data usage if you are using VoLTE for your video calls. To check your mobile data consumption with a phone call: On your Verizon phone, open the dialer app. Enter #DATA or #3282. Click the call button. Once you've dialed the correct pound code, you should receive a text message or an on-screen pop-up with information on your data usage for that billing cycle.

If you have a contract in your home state, you can. keep using it.Verizon wireless surcharges include (i) a Regulatory Charge (which helps defray various government charges we pay including government number administration and license fees); (ii) a Federal Universal Service Charge (and, if applicable, a State Universal Service Charge) to recover charges imposed on us by the government to support universal ...May 22, 2023 · 5G UW stands for 5G Ultra Wideband. It's a marketing term Verizon uses to identify one type of its 5G network. So when you see the 5G UW icon in your iPhone or Android phone 's status bar, it means you are connected to Verizon's 5G Ultra Wideband network. Notably, many Android phones show the 5G UWB icon instead of the 5G UW icon when connected ... However, Verizon faced another challenge. 4G/LTE signals were already traveling on those airwaves, meaning Verizon’s new 5G Nationwide service had to share the road with a significant amount of ...Verizon is an American wireless network operator that previously operated as a separate division of Verizon Communications under the name Verizon Wireless. In a 2019 reorganization, Verizon moved the wireless products and services into the divisions Verizon Consumer and Verizon Business, and stopped using the Verizon Wireless name.

This is one of the more common reasons you will get this message in the modern era.Both CDMA and GSM are multiple-access technologies, meaning they allow multiple calls or data connections on one radio channel. GSM transforms calls into digital data, gives them a shared channel and a time slot and puts the pieces of each call back together for the listener on the other end. International calling to Canada, Puerto Rico, US Virgin Islands, and Mexico and 5 Mbps mobile hotspot are also ...Latency is the amount of time it takes for a signal to travel to and from a network server. Lower latency means faster response time, and vice versa. 5G offers an extremely low latency rate. The specification for true 5G calls for about 1 millisecond, while 4G’s ideal rate is 10ms. What is 5G New Radio? 5G is the fifth generation of wireless technology and NR stands for a new radio interface and radio access technology for cellular networks—a physical connection method for radio based communication. Other kinds of radio access technologies include Bluetooth, Wi-Fi and 4G LTE. With such a wide customer base, it’s no surprise that Verizon has stores all across the coun...T-Mobile is also using more of the mid-band airwaves than others. Typically, T-Mobile would serve up to 110MHz, while AT&T uses around 40MHz and Verizon uses around 60MHz. T-Mobile also uses its 600MHz low-band spectrum on LTE Band 71, which was formerly used by channels 38 to 51 on UHF-based TVs.
